Remove CROSSMEMBER - Ar64.20-P-1060-10XG

Model 463 as of model year 2019 

IMPORTANT The following operation steps are shown on the left side of the vehicle. In case of damage on the right side of the vehicle, these steps must be performed analogously.

The higher-level service information as well as the safety information must be observed.

  1. Mark separating point on crossmember (3) and cut (area A).
  2. Expose and cut off spot welds at crossmember (3) (areas B).

    IMPORTANT Dimensions:

    a = approx. 65 mm

  3. Expose and cut off spot welds at crossmember (3) (area C).
  4. Expose spot weld at crossmember (3) and drill out from inside with Ø 6.5 mm (area E).

    IMPORTANT Spot weld is not visible from outside.

  5. Heat crossmember (3) in crosshatched areas.

    IMPORTANT Cross-hatched areas are bonded with adhesive.

  6. Remove crossmember (3).

  7. Sand down mating surfaces to bare metal in cross-hatched areas.

    IMPORTANT Sand down spot weld flanges to bare metal on both sides.

  8. Remove grinding dust and drill chips.
  9. Coat insides of spot weld flanges with zinc dust paint.

NOTES Do not apply zinc dust paint to bonding surfaces (area D).

Otherwise adhesion problems may occur.

IMPORTANT Observe pretreatment of bonding surfaces.
